Expressing Birthday Joy: "Happy Birthday to Me" in Hindi
So, you wanna shout from the rooftops (or, you know, post on Instagram) that it's your special day? Saying "Happy Birthday to me!" in Hindi can add that extra tadka of cultural flavor. Here’s how you can do it:
- मेरा जन्मदिन मुबारक! (Mera Janamdin Mubarak!): This is the most direct translation and probably the easiest to remember. Mera means "my," Janamdin means "birthday," and Mubarak means "congratulations" or "happy." So, putting it all together, you're literally saying, "Happy birthday to me!"
- आज मेरा जन्मदिन है! (Aaj Mera Janamdin Hai!): This translates to "Today is my birthday!" Aaj means "today," so you’re emphasizing the here and now of your special day. It's a simple yet effective way to announce your birthday to the world.
Diving Deeper: Adding Emotion to Your Birthday Wishes
Okay, so you know the basic translations. But what if you want to add a little masala to your expression? Here are a few ways to spice it up:
- मैं बहुत खुश हूँ कि आज मेरा जन्मदिन है! (Main bahut khush hun ki aaj mera janamdin hai!): This translates to "I am very happy that today is my birthday!" If you're feeling particularly joyful, this is the phrase to use. It conveys your happiness and excitement.
- यह मेरा खास दिन है! (Yeh mera khaas din hai!): This means "This is my special day!" Birthdays are special, after all, so why not emphasize it? This phrase is perfect for highlighting the significance of the day.

The Cultural Significance of Birthdays in India
In India, birthdays are a big deal! They’re often celebrated with family gatherings, delicious food, and traditional ceremonies. Here are a few common birthday traditions you might encounter:
- Puja: Many families perform a puja (prayer ceremony) to seek blessings for the birthday person. This is often done to ensure good health and prosperity in the coming year.
- Temple Visits: Visiting a temple on your birthday is another common practice. It’s a way to start the year with spiritual blessings and positive energy.
- Sweet Treats: No Indian celebration is complete without sweets! From ladoos to barfi, there’s always a delicious array of treats to indulge in on your birthday.

Common Birthday Greetings in Hindi
Besides saying "Happy Birthday to me," you'll likely hear others wishing you well. Here are some common birthday greetings in Hindi you might encounter:
- जन्मदिन मुबारक हो! (Janmadin Mubarak Ho!): This is the standard "Happy Birthday!" greeting. It’s simple, versatile, and always appreciated.
- तुम्हें जन्मदिन की हार्दिक शुभकामनाएं! (Tumhe janmadin ki hardik shubhkamnaaye!): This translates to "Heartfelt wishes for your birthday!" It's a more formal and heartfelt way to wish someone a happy birthday.
- यह जन्मदिन तुम्हारे जीवन में खुशियाँ लाए! (Yeh janmadin tumhare jeevan mein khushiyan laaye!): This means "May this birthday bring happiness to your life!" It’s a beautiful and thoughtful wish for the birthday person.
Responding to Birthday Wishes
So, you’ve received a flood of birthday wishes. How do you respond? Here are a few phrases you can use:
- धन्यवाद! (Dhanyavaad!): This simply means "Thank you!" It’s a polite and easy way to acknowledge a birthday wish.
- आपका बहुत बहुत धन्यवाद! (Aapka bahut bahut dhanyavaad!): This translates to "Thank you very much!" Use this when you want to express extra gratitude.
- आपकी शुभकामनाओं के लिए धन्यवाद! (Aapki shubhkamnaon ke liye dhanyavaad!): This means "Thank you for your good wishes!" It’s a more specific way to thank someone for their birthday greeting.
